DAILY HOPE DEVOTIONAL: JANUARY 22 THE MIGHTY HAND OF GOD (1) Scripture: 1 Peter 5: 6 – 7

Posted on January 22, 2023 by admin
Spread the love

 

The world is full of people who others referred to as paramount, majesty, great achievers, unbeatable and other names depicting supper-attained position. Most of these people had ruled their world seeing themselves stronger than any other beings. These people are feared by other mortal beings; in the awareness of who they are and the powers they welded. Many nations have been ruled with men or women of terror-minded leadership. More nations are still under tyrants and blood tasting leaders. The irony of life is that all these people ruled or are ruling with mortality. Therefore, come a time an Almighty hands come discomfiting all their mightiness. The owner of these almighty hands is Jehovah God.

This devotional is introducing the readers to the “The Mighty Hand Of God.” It is considered very important to do exposure on “Mighty Hand of God” in this present age given how mortal leaders have made themselves gods of the less privileges. Many leaders – political, traditional and religious people have transformed themselves to satanic and inhuman leaders. Most of these leaders lead or rule without the fear of Almighty God. Laws are promulgated without recourse to the negative effects the laws have on the poor and the less privileged. Many of our leaders have turned real anti godliness and anti-Jesus Christ and God. Most of our leaders have failed in humbling themselves under “The Mighty Hand of God” (1 Peter 5: 6).

No matter what people in the world turn to, God remains Almighty God and His Hand remains the “Mighty Hand of God.” Subsequent discussions on this topic will touch areas in the scripture that attest to the fact that God’ Hand is “Mighty Hand” against that of any being. The beloved, understand this, that the greatest knowledge any human being must know is the knowledge of believing that God is Almighty and His hands are mighty hands. With all the mightiness of King Nebuchadnezzar, he got to acknowledge that God is mightier, after he was driven into the bush for seven years. He said this of God: “And all the inhabitants of the earth are reputed as nothing: and he doeth according to his will in the army of heaven, and among the inhabitants of the earth: and none can stay his hand, or say unto him, What doest thou?” (Daniel 4: 35). Because God’s Hand is Mighty, King Nebuchadnezzar said that no one can stay His hand or say to Him what are doing?

PRAYER:

My Father, my God, kindly reveal to me the mightiness of your hands in heaven and under the earth in the name of Jesus Christ. Enable me to trust in the mightiness of your hands all the days of my life on earth.
